    The singer has realized he needs to slow down in life. Get out of the fast lane where you can never get ahead. He realized he has missed a lot and has some things to find. He wasn't stopping to smell the roses.

    "Here comes a mermaid and a little girl, Saw open drawers from around the world."

    Here comes his little girl (slowpoke) and he has been busy traveling around the world for work.

    I got some medals hanging on my chest, I've seen some good ones, but I missed the rest.

    Whether actually war battles or just a way of saying he's done his time and been through a lot.

    Slowpoke I'm gonna run with you, Wear all your clothes and do what you do. Slowpoke we got some things to find, When I was faster, I was always behind.

    He is going to play with his little girl in her outfits and she can do whatever she wants to do. They have some things to find together. Later the verse changes to 'I've got some things to find' as well.

Standing On The Edge Of Summer
Thursday
In regards to the meaning of this song: Before a live performance on the EP Five Stories Falling, Geoff states “It’s about the last time I went to visit my grandmother in Columbus, and I saw that she was dying and it was the last time I was going to see her. It is about realizing how young you are, but how quickly you can go.” That’s the thing about Geoff and his sublime poetry, you think it’s about one thing, but really it’s about something entirely different. But the lyrics are still universal and omnipresent, ubiquitous, even. So relatable. That’s one thing I love about this band. I Can't Go To Sleep
Wu-Tang Clan
This song is written as the perspective of the boys in the street, as a whole, and what path they are going to choose as they get older and grow into men. (This is why the music video takes place in an orphanage.) The seen, and unseen collective suffering is imbedded in the boys’ mind, consciously or subconsciously, and is haunting them. Which path will the boys choose? Issac Hayes is the voice of reason, maybe God, the angel on his shoulder, or the voice of his forefathers from beyond the grave who can see the big picture and are pleading with the boys not to continue the violence and pattern of killing their brothers, but to rise above. The most beautiful song and has so many levels. Racism towards African Americans in America would not exist if everyone sat down and listened to this song and understood the history behind the words. The power, fear, pleading in RZA and Ghostface voices are genuine and powerful. Issac Hayes’ strong voice makes the perfect strong father figure, who is possibly from beyond the grave.
